Position Summary The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) provides direct, hands-on care and assistance to residents in accordance with individualized care plans and under the supervision of licensed nursing staff. The CNA is responsible for supporting residents with activities of daily living while promoting dignity, independence, comfort, and quality of life. Essential Duties and Responsibilities Provide assistance with activities of daily living, including bathing, dressing, grooming, toileting, mobility, and eating. Assist residents with repositioning, transfers, ambulation, and range-of-motion activities as directed. Observe and report changes in residents' physical, mental, or emotional condition to licensed nursing staff. Take and record vital signs, weights, and other assigned measurements. Assist residents with maintaining a clean, safe, and comfortable environment. Respond promptly to resident call lights and requests for assistance. Document care and services provided accurately and timely. Follow infection control, safety, and resident rights policies and procedures. Communicate respectfully and effectively with residents, families, and members of the healthcare team. Participate in maintaining a positive, resident-centered environment. Qualifications Current and valid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) certification and/or registration as required by applicable state regulations. Previous experience in long-term care or skilled nursing is preferred but not required. Ability to provide compassionate and respectful care to residents. Strong communication and teamwork skills. Ability to perform the physical requirements of the position, including assisting residents with mobility and transfers.
